Here are three practical tips that will help you create a powerful online brand.
1.Choose a Memorable Name
Finding a memorable brand name can be a frustrating experience. It needs to be simple so people can pronounce and spell it easily, but it also needs to be unique and meaningful. Even if you find a name that you love, there’s no guarantee that you will find the associated domain name available.
Unfortunately, there is no clear path to finding the ideal brand name. Still, you can simplify the search process with strategic brainstorming. A good tip is to write down any words you associate with your online project. Include values, goals, qualities, characteristics, then expand your list with other relevant descriptors. This list of words can serve as a starting point in your search. Alternatively, you can use an online name generator.
2.Create an Impactful Visual Identity
Elements such as website design, logo, social media cover photos, product photography, typography, and color palette create your visual brand identity. An online brand needs an impactful visual identity to stand out in the digital landscape, so it’s essential to cover all these details as soon as you choose a brand name.
Is your startup budget low? You can create impactful visuals for your project using free stock photography and free online design and photo editing tools. With a free logo design tool, you can create an eye-catching logo in a matter of minutes.
3.Build a Strong Social Media Presence
To build a powerful online brand, you will need a supportive community of fans and followers enthusiastic about what you have to offer. Creating an attractive website is not enough if you’re looking to reach as many people as possible as quickly as possible. You also need to be active on popular social media platforms where people can easily find you and share your products or services.
To find success on social media, it’s important to see it not only as a promotional tool but also as a way of connecting with your target audience. Social media allows two-way communication, which is incredibly valuable for fostering a strong connection with your community that translates into strong brand recognition and customer loyalty.
Share valuable content with your social media communities to build credibility, showcase your expertise, and earn trust. Industry updates, educational articles, and unique market insights are examples of content that your followers may appreciate.
